Situated near the Cranborne Chase and West Wiltshire Downs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ty, the location boasts an array of scenic walking trails. One notable highlight is Bulbarrow Hill, one of Dorset's highest points, where visitors can relish breathtaking views across the Blackmore Vale. The area is rich in attractions, with ancient towns like Sherborne and historic sites such as Shaftesbury and Stourhead House and Gardens within easy reach. Additionally, the renowned Jurassic Coast offers a unique opportunity for exploration and enjoyment.
